Where does “aardpek” come from?

aardpek (Dutch) comes from Dutch pek, from Middle Dutch pec, from Old Dutch pek, from Proto-Germanic *pīk, from Latin pix, from Proto-Indo-European pik-, from Proto-Indo-European pi- — sap, juice.

aardpek (Dutch): mineral pitch, bitumen

Definitions

  1. mineral pitch, bitumen
